Product Specifications and Technical Details
The Cylindrical Cell for Far UV Quartz is engineered with meticulous attention to detail. It boasts a 2mm light path, which is crucial for accurate light transmission in the far UV range. The cell's capacity of 560µL is suitable for a wide range of applications, from small-volume samples to larger experiments. Additionally, the cell is designed with a secure seal to prevent sample evaporation and contamination, ensuring the integrity of your results.- Capacity: 560µL
- Material: Far-ultraviolet grade quartz
- Light Path: 2mm
